11th Motorized Infantry Division (People's Republic of China)
The 11th Motorized Infantry Division (11th MID) is a formation of the People's Liberation Army Ground Force (PLAGF) of the People's Republic of China. Specific details regarding its current organization, equipment, and deployment are not readily available in open-source information. Information regarding the division's history, operational deployments, and current status is largely classified.
While precise details are scarce, it is known that the 11th MID, like other motorized infantry divisions in the PLAGF, is a combined arms formation composed of infantry, armor, artillery, and support elements. Its primary role is likely to be conventional warfare within the context of a larger theater of operations. Its motorized designation indicates a reliance on wheeled and tracked vehicles for troop and equipment movement.
